About Singhola Chetsingh Village
Singhola Chetsingh is a mid sized village in Gunnaur tehsil, in the district of Budaun, Uttar Pradesh. The Census of India 2011 recorded a population of 1,877, made up of 995 males and 882 females. That works out to a sex ratio of about 886 females per 1000 males. The village covers 433.02 hectares hectares. Its pincode is 202527, shared with the other villages in the same post office area.

Getting to Singhola Chetsingh
The census records public bus service for Singhola Chetsingh as Available within <5 km distance. Private bus service is recorded as Available within <5 km distance. For rail, the census notes the nearest railway station as Available within 10+ km distance. These entries describe what was recorded in 2011 and services may have changed since.
